GEOFF.223 83 Posted December 18, 2012 Report Share Posted December 18, 2012 only really worth one if your zero-ing 10 rifles a day. i just pull bolt out bore sight with eye, you will find ballistic inform that will give you information like zero at 50yards and it will be close at 200yards every cal will be different as you know its the fastest why i have tried so far. i zerod my 22-250 at 200yards the guy i bought it off had it zerod at 250 just depends on your average shooting distance. Deker 3,491 Posted December 18, 2012 Report Share Posted December 18, 2012 Alli GEOFF.223 has really covered it above, most people can bore sight by eye close enough, and whatever you use you will need to finish with live fire anyway! I run 8 FAC rifles, I'm Secretary of a Fullbore Club at Bisley and I have no need for a Laser Bore Sight. But the choice is yours! Zero at the distance you expect to be shooting most of your quarry! 1 Quote Link to post

tegater 789 Posted December 18, 2012 Report Share Posted December 18, 2012 Knock the primer out of a case and use as Geoff and Deker. It just makes a slightly smaller aperture in the bore. That's all I use anyway. Quote Link to post
